CP Capital Limited's Board, at its meeting on February 12, 2026, approved the Unaudited Standalone and Consolidated Financial Results for Q3FY26 and 9MFY26 (quarter and nine months ended December 31, 2025), reviewed by statutory auditors S.P. Chopra & Co. On a standalone basis, Q3FY26 Revenue from Operations rose 6.4% YoY to Rs. 1,632.90 Lakhs, Interest Income grew strongly by 17.8% YoY to Rs. 1,387.14 Lakhs, and Profit After Tax stood at Rs. 984.19 Lakhs (+5.9% YoY, +20.1% QoQ) with EPS of Rs. 5.41. Consolidated performance was much stronger, with Total Revenue up 41.2% YoY to Rs. 2,039.02 Lakhs and Consolidated PAT surging 43.9% YoY to Rs. 1,249.71 Lakhs, taking Consolidated EPS to Rs. 6.87 (vs Rs. 4.78 in Q3FY25). For 9MFY26, Consolidated PAT was Rs. 3,344.08 Lakhs (+13.3% YoY) on Total Revenue of Rs. 5,787.64 Lakhs. The Company also noted its NBFC registration with RBI effective April 1, 2025, following the Composite Scheme of Arrangement involving amalgamation and demerger completed earlier.
